Azeri Defense Minister Lieutenant General Zakir Hasanov has said Baku will not allow its territory to be used for any action against the Islamic Republic.
In a meeting with Iranian Deputy Defense Minister Brigadier General Qasem Taqizadeh in Baku on Saturday, the Azeri minister said his country will by no means allow its soil and airspace to be used against the Islamic Republic.
He said Tehran and Baku enjoy longstanding friendship, adding that Azerbaijan attaches great significance to good ties with Iran.
The Azeri official also called for the development of defense cooperation between the two neighboring countries.
The Iranian official, for his part, said the Islamic Republic is ready to further develop defense ties with Azerbaijan.
Last month, Iran’s Islamic Revolution Guards Corps (IRGC) said its forces had intercepted and shot down an Israeli spy drone with a surface-to-air missile. The Israeli-made Hermes drone was heading to Natanz nuclear facility in the central Iranian province of Isfahan.
Some media reports claimed that the drone was launched from Azerbaijan’s territory. Azeri officials have denied the reports.
